Hello All,

I have been out of the photography world for quite some time, I just had my first child which has sparked me taking a lot more photos and gaining an interest again! :allteeth:

I was thinking of selling everything I have lenses included and purchasing the 6D kit with the 24-105 f/4L lens. What do you think? 6D body only and buy a different lens? I know a lot of people still use the 5D classic, should I keep it and just invest in better glass instead? I plan on doing a lot of portrait type photos.

I am a Nikon boy but my friend and mentor I work with in events use only his Canon 6D
Really good camera, a bit basic in AF department but if you don't do any sports shooting then the 6D is plenty good and the sensor on it is actually a little bit better then the one on the 5D III

So while I am sure many if not most will tell you to upgraded lenses I would say get the 6D with the 24-105mm which is a good general use lens
